Halo Design and Dangle Structure
Halo settings are widely used in gemstone jewelry to frame a central stone with smaller surrounding
stones. This arrangement increases the visual brightness of the design while drawing attention to the
centerpiece.
In dangle earrings, the halo design is paired with a suspended structure that introduces movement,
allowing the gemstones to reflect light from multiple angles as the earrings move.
Ethiopian Opal Gemstone Characteristics
Ethiopian opal is known for its distinctive play-of-color, where flashes of multiple hues can appear
across the surface of the gemstone when exposed to light. This optical effect gives opal jewelry a
unique and expressive appearance.
The round shape of the opal provides symmetry and balance, allowing the gemstone’s natural color
patterns to remain the central visual feature of the design.
